Cheers from Lugano, Pietro Il giorno 19-feb-2019, alle ore 16:19, Patrick Sanan <[email protected]<mailto:[email protected]>> ha scritto: Will it work for you to use https://www.mcs.anl.gov/petsc/petsc-current/docs/manualpages/PC/PCMGGetSmoother.html to pull out the KSP for the level you're interested in (Note link to PCMGGetSmootherDown() if you want to control up and down smoothers separately) and then use https://www.mcs.anl.gov/petsc/petsc-current/docs/manualpages/KSP/KSPSetTolerances.html to set the maximum iterations?
